Q: Is 7,165,616 a Prime Number?
A: No, 7,165,616 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 7165616 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 16 79 158 316 632 1,264 5,669 11,338 22,676 45,352 90,704 447,851 895,702 1,791,404 3,582,808 and 7,165,616, with no remainder.
Since 7,165,616 cannot be divided by just 1 and 7,165,616, it is not a prime number.
